B‑Tech System‑2 50mm Pole (1.5m)
About this product

B-Tech BT7850-150/B System‑2 Pole — 1.5 m Ø50 mm pole for ceiling, floor or floor‑to‑ceiling AV installations. Constructed from 1.6 mm steel with internally unobstructed tubing for neat cable routing. Supplied with a finishing ring; poles can be linked with joiners or cut to exact length.

  • Length: 1.5 m (BT7850‑150)
  • Outer diameter: Ø50 mm (System‑2)
  • Steel wall thickness: 1.6 mm
  • Manufacturer maximum load: 140 kg (309 lb) — use this rating unless an accessory or installation constraint reduces safe load
  • Internal cable pass‑through and safety bolt holes top & bottom
  • Compatible with BT7823/BT7824 joiners and BT7052/BT7057 accessory collars

Use cases: Ideal for installers and integrators mounting displays, projectors or other AV equipment where a wall fix is not suitable. Poles are suitable for commercial and professional AV installations; can be cut to length on site.

Detailed specifications and benefits

The BT7850‑150/B is constructed from 1.6 mm steel tube with an outer diameter of 50 mm, a size commonly referred to as System‑2 in the B‑Tech modular range. This diameter strikes a strong balance between visual proportion and structural capacity: it is substantial enough to support heavier AV equipment while remaining discreet and easy to install in most commercial interiors.

Steel construction ensures long‑term durability and resistance to bending under load. The 1.6 mm wall thickness increases stiffness compared with thinner alternatives, reducing deflection when supporting displays or projector assemblies. The tube is internally unobstructed to allow cables to be run through its center, preserving a neat aesthetic and protecting cabling from wear or accidental damage.

The pole has a manufacturer maximum load rating of 140 kg (309 lb). This rating should be used as the baseline when planning installations, but installers must also consider the effects of accessories, mounting hardware and the strength of the mounting surfaces. Safety bolt holes at both ends are provided so that poles can be mechanically locked into place once positioned. For any installation, follow the official B‑Tech specification sheet and installation guide and ensure local building regulations and anchor ratings are suitable for the applied loads.

The BT7850‑150/B is supplied with a finishing ring and is compatible with System‑2 joiners (BT7823/BT7824) and accessory collars (BT7052/BT7057). Poles can be linked with joiners to create custom lengths, or cut on site to the exact required length for floor‑to‑ceiling installations or bespoke fit outs. Available in multiple finishes (Black, Chrome, White) depending on length, the pole adapts to both functional and aesthetic requirements, making it a go‑to choice for integrators who need simplicity plus modularity.

Comparisons with similar products in the market

When choosing a mounting pole, buyers typically compare diameter, material, load rating, cable management and modularity. Here is how the BT7850‑150/B stacks up against common alternatives:

  • Smaller diameter poles (e.g., 40 mm):Slimmer poles can be more discreet and lighter to handle, but they usually have lower load ratings and may deflect more under heavy displays. The 50 mm System‑2 diameter provides added stiffness and the ability to support heavier AV loads without a dramatic visual footprint.
  • Aluminium poles:Aluminium offers corrosion resistance and lighter weight, but steel poles like the BT7850‑150/B typically provide higher rigidity and lower cost for equivalent wall thicknesses. For heavy loads and fixed commercial installations, steel is often preferred.
  • Telescopic poles:Adjustable telescopic poles are convenient for uncertain heights, but they can introduce potential points of movement and sometimes lower overall strength. The fixed 1.5 m pole is simple, robust and can be cut or joined to ensure a permanent, tight fit without telescopic complexity.
  • Full suspension kits vs single pole approach:Suspension kits that include multiple components can be ideal for complex ceiling grids, but a single well‑specified pole is quicker to deploy, hides cables internally and often offers better value for straightforward vertical mounts.
